Not your fail. This is a known issue. I believe the AOB is reset every time you update the other information in the TDC. It needs to be the last bit of data you enter.

Happy hunting! :salute:

that is correct, in the stock game, you have to enter AOB last to get an accurate solution.

I agree, stadimeter isn't very accurate and even adjusting it very carefully flotation line/top of masts usually give an error +- 100m further 90% of time.

I saw this using boats icons on map and solution line.
Mesuring distance to icon with ruler, and putting manually distance in stadi, the solution line just reach the boat icon...now using only stadimeter, solution line is off by at least 100 m :doh:

As the distance is corrupted further, i usually set the stadi a little more higher than the top mast.
